Grubbing services involve the removal of unwanted tree stumps, roots, and other underground obstructions from residential, commercial, or industrial properties. This process typically requires specialized equipment to effectively excavate and eliminate these features, making the land suitable for future construction, landscaping, or other development projects. The service helps clear the way for new structures or plantings and can improve the overall appearance and safety of a property by eliminating tripping hazards and preventing pest infestations that can occur around decaying roots.
One of the primary problems that grubbing services address is the presence of stubborn tree stumps and roots that hinder property use or development. Stumps left after tree removal can attract pests such as termites or beetles, and their decay can lead to fungal growth or soil instability. Additionally, remaining roots may interfere with grading, landscaping, or the installation of new features like driveways or lawns. Grubbing helps mitigate these issues by thoroughly removing the underground remnants, ensuring the land is level, stable, and ready for subsequent projects.
Properties that commonly utilize grubbing services include residential yards, commercial parcels, and agricultural land. Homes with landscaping projects often require stump removal to prepare for new gardens or lawn installations. Commercial properties, especially those planning new construction or parking lot expansion, benefit from grubbing to facilitate groundwork and foundation work. Agricultural land may also need stump removal to improve soil quality and make the land more accessible for farming equipment or future crop planting.

The overview below groups typical Grubbing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Blue Ridge, GA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Per Square Foot Cost - Grubbing services typically range from $1 to $3 per square foot, depending on the project scope. For example, clearing a small backyard might cost around $500, while larger areas could reach $1,500 or more.
Hourly Rates - Contractors often charge between $50 and $100 per hour for grubbing work. The total cost depends on the project's complexity and the number of labor hours required.
Flat-Rate Projects - Some service providers offer flat-rate pricing for specific projects, such as driveway clearing or lot preparation. Prices can vary from $1,000 to $4,000 based on size and site conditions.
Additional Costs - Extra charges may apply for stump removal, debris hauling, or difficult terrain, which can add several hundred dollars to the overall cost. These costs depend on the site’s specific requirements and accessibility.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
